Transaction f71fcbd89671e774b41c09153fd82710992aaa34a21c31a2fc9b3f8958b2bd8b
1 Input
1 Output
-
f71fcbd89671e774b41c09153fd82710992aaa34a21c31a2fc9b3f8958b2bd8b:0
- value
- 532868758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19bb9315aedac77e76a1f347973a0b5c2a8d96a4 OP_EQUAL
- address
- MAFDq8jVUXN82U3frYRPzreUkzVFjsgAbs